Casey Wiegmann has been chosen as the Chiefs' starting center over incumbent Rudy Niswanger.

The 37-year-old returned to the Chiefs this offseason after spending two years in Denver. Niswanger has trouble with bigger nose tackles and too often struggles with bad snaps, so it's not a surprise that the Chiefs decided to go with the veteran.

Derrick Johnson has beaten out Demorrio Williams for one of the starting inside linebacker spots for the Chiefs.

The other inside linebacker starting spot also appears to have been decided, as Jovan Belcher has been picked over Corey Mays. Johnson has been a big disappointment in Kansas City but still has a lot of ability. Williams is likely to replace Johnson on passing downs.

Percy Harvin collapsed during Thursday's practice and was taken to the hospital in an ambulance.

Coach Brad Childress said that Harvin had an "episode" and not really a "seizure." It was apparently triggered when Harvin looked at the sky on a punt return and is almost certainly related to his migraine woes. Harvin was trembling and partially responsive as medical personnel got him off the field. This is scary stuff as the Vikings held a team prayer afterward.

Chiefs coach Todd Haley said Monday that Jamaal Charles' role is "still to be determined."

Thomas Jones remains atop the depth chart. Haley referred to Charles as "a developing player" who's "had good days, bad days, and in-between days." "They both understand what’s going on," Haley added. "It’s a good situation." This is the strongest indication yet that Haley is listing Charles behind Jones in an effort to create a "competitive situation," and motivate the young back. Haley did the same with Dwayne Bowe in 2009. Bowe started in Week 1.

Dwayne Bowe worked as the Chiefs' first-team split end at the start of Organized Team Activities Monday.

Bowe was going to be a starter regardless as easily Kansas City's most gifted wide receiver, but this is notable because he ran with the second and third teams throughout last offseason after reporting out of shape. Bowe appears to be physically fit this time around.
